Output 3f937ef0402eb34deaaa4ae9e8bb8ed392869959b89fe1089e3f2036c12db2f2:5

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89c19775f058a501b0f3e70de0e2c437084e837d OP_EQUAL
address
3EFQQooQBLsewkm9eZa7b6hPLVmAeKYRZW
transaction
3f937ef0402eb34deaaa4ae9e8bb8ed392869959b89fe1089e3f2036c12db2f2
spent
true